Cheapest Available Taylor 4 Bedroom Apartments

As of September 02, 2026 the lowest priced 4 Bedroom apartment unit in Taylor, TX is the Williamson Model starting from $2,139 at Linea Stillwater in the Georgetown Village neighborhood. The second most affordable Taylor 4 Bedroom is the Plan 6 Model at Tricon Saddle Creek starting at $2,159 in the Taylor Hutto neighborhood. The average price for all 4 Bedroom apartments in Taylor is currently $2,809.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 4 Bedroom options in Taylor:

Frequently Asked Questions about Taylor

How much are Studio apartments in Taylor?

There are currently 11 Studio Apartments in Taylor with rent ranges from $795 to $1,522 with an average price of $1,221.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Taylor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Taylor ranges from $540 to $4,041 with an average monthly rent of $1,442.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Taylor c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Taylor range from $1,025 to $6,157.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,816.

How expensive are Taylor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 56 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Taylor on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,300 to $5,457 - averaging $2,145 for the location.
